Treatment оI’barley seedlings with 100 mM NaCl for 7 days caused a significant
decline in plant growth but the plants remained turgid and healthy. Hill reaction activity
of isolated thylakoids was lowered by approximately 25% after 100 mM NaCl (Table

plant growth was slightly affected, and the electron transport activity of isolated
thylakoids should an insignificant inhibition.'These results are supported by the
investigations of the chlorophyll fluorescence induction in isolated thylakoids. After a
long-term 100 itiM NaCl treatment a decrease in the Fv/Fm» ratio was obtained (Fv-
variable fluorescence and
- maximum level o f fluorescence), whereas in stepwise-
treated plants this ratio was between the values of control and NaCl stressed plants.
